Khadidja Otmane Rachedi is a scholar working on Organic Chemistry, Materials Chemistry and Civil and Structural Engineering. According to data from OpenAlex, Khadidja Otmane Rachedi has authored 20 papers receiving a total of 434 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Organic Chemistry, 8 papers in Materials Chemistry and 7 papers in Civil and Structural Engineering. Recurrent topics in Khadidja Otmane Rachedi's work include Corrosion Behavior and Inhibition (8 papers), Concrete Corrosion and Durability (7 papers) and Synthesis and Characterization of Heterocyclic Compounds (5 papers). Khadidja Otmane Rachedi is often cited by papers focused on Corrosion Behavior and Inhibition (8 papers), Concrete Corrosion and Durability (7 papers) and Synthesis and Characterization of Heterocyclic Compounds (5 papers). Khadidja Otmane Rachedi collaborates with scholars based in Algeria, France and Saudi Arabia. Khadidja Otmane Rachedi's co-authors include Malika Berredjem, Taïbi Ben Hadda, Rania Bahadi, Hana Ferkous, Abdeslem Bouzina, Billel Belhani, Yacine Benguerba, Amel Delimi, Tan‐Sothéa Ouk and Manawwer Alam and has published in prestigious journals such as Journal of Molecular Liquids, Process Safety and Environmental Protection and Arabian Journal of Chemistry.
